区块链数据安全机制原理,区块链数据安全
区块链数据安全机制原理解析

1. 分布式存储保障数据安全

区块链采用分布式存储技术,将数据分散存储在多个节点上,每个节点都保存了完整的数据副本。这种分布式存储结构使得数据无法被单一节点篡改或破坏,从而保障了数据的安全性。
2. 去中心化确保数据不被篡改

区块链的去中心化特性意味着没有单一的控制中心,每个节点都可以参与到数据验证和记录的过程中。当有新的数据产生时,需要经过网络中多个节点的验证,并经过共识算法达成一致后才能被添加到区块链中,这有效地防止了数据被篡改。
3. 加密算法保护数据隐私

区块链中采用的加密算法对数据进行加密处理,确保数据在传输和存储过程中不会被窃取或篡改。只有拥有相应私钥的用户才能对数据进行解密和操作,从而保护了数据的隐私性。
4. 智能合约实现自动化安全控制

区块链中的智能合约是一种自动化执行的计算代码,可以根据预先设定的规则和条件执行相应的操作。通过智能合约,可以实现诸如权限管理、数据访问控制等安全控制功能,提高了数据的安全性和可靠性。
5. 不可逆的数据记录确保数据可追溯

区块链中的数据一旦被记录到区块链上就不可篡改,所有的数据操作都会被永久记录下来。这种不可逆的特性保证了数据的可追溯性,任何对数据的修改都会被永久记录,从而增强了数据的可信度和安全性。
总结
区块链数据安全机制的原理是通过分布式存储、去中心化、加密算法、智能合约和不可逆记录等多种技术手段来保障数据的安全性、隐私性和可靠性,为数据的存储和传输提供了更加安全和可信的环境。